
New York based artist Kayode Ojo works in multi-media, from photography to installations. With a BFA in photography from the School of Visual Arts, the artist weaves image-making with found objects and performance to create a cohesive narrative exploring the construction/deconstruction of identities, consumer culture, and reconciling seemingly disparate binaries. With favorable reviews from a variety of outlets--from The New York Times to Garage--and shows in Los Angeles, New York, Paris, Berlin, Milan, Greece and beyond, the artist is poised to rise.
